After breakfast we will depart for Steve Biko’s home and Steve Biko Garden of Resemblance where his grave is.
Steve Biko died in the hands of the South African Police while on the struggle for the liberation of the oppressed in South Africa.
On the way we will stop by to see the a local creche( day care center) started by Steve biko and his wife,as well as there is a medical clinic that we can visit as well that was also started by him as well.
Our visit to the Amatole Museum popular for its natural history and also the last resting place for “HUBERTA” the Hippo who known worldwide for her wanderings in the 1930’s, will give you more insight in to the lifestyle/culture of the locals…
This town also has a large variety of church buildings with varied architectural styles which we will pass by stopping at some of them coupled with the older buildings that have been preserved will give you a moment to step back in time.
